    Putin weighs future options as he marks 20 years in power

    " MOSCOW - As Russian President Vladimir Putin marks two decades in power, he boasts about his achievements but remains coy about his political future - a reticence that fuels wild speculation about his intentions.

    Putin points to the revival of Russia's global clout, industrial modernization, booming agricultural exports and a resurgent military as key results of his tenure that began on Dec. 31, 1999. On that day, Russias first president, Boris Yeltsin, abruptly stepped down and named the former KGB officer his successor, paving the way for his election three months later. "
